2021 Digital News Report: How Much Do We Trust The News Media?
from Pressing Matters · host BFM Media
The 2021 Digital News Report compiled by the Reuters Institute for the Study of Journalism revealed that trust in the media increased by 6% globally to 44%, as audiences sought credible, authoritative news sources during the pandemic. Malaysia saw a similar uptick in trust in media, but with media freedoms on the decline under Perikatan Nasional, Professor Zaharom Nain of University Nottingham Malaysia believes the trend is unsustainable. We discuss the findings of the report in the Malaysian context, and other trends in media consumption over the past year.
